Lenton Devotional

2008

 

February 9

Don't let what you can't do interfere with what you can do.

Author Unknown


There are parts of a ship which taken by themselves would sink.  The engine would sink.  The propeller would sink.  But when the parts of a ship are built together, they float.  So with the events of my life.  Some have been tragic.  Some have been happy.  But when they are built together, they form a craft that floats and is going someplace.  And I am comforted.

Ralph W. Sockman

 

Happiness does not come from doing easy work but from the afterglow of satisfaction that comes after the achievement of a difficult task that demanded our best.
Theodore Isaac Rubin

 

A successful person is one who can lay a firm foundation with the bricks that others throw at him or her.  

Psalms 75:6

 

Dear Lord, Thank you for the promise of Your word.  Help me to always do my best remembering that there are things I can't do. When I face challenges that leave me breathless, let me lean on you. When I hesitate to take the next step, give me a gentle nudge to get me going. Help me to always remember that when I face a road block, you will show me the way and tell me what I can do.  Amen
